Top Software Engineer Jobs in Toronto, ON
Seeking a Manager, Product Engineering with 8-10 years of experience in Software Engineering, Quality Assurance, Cloud Infrastructure, or DevOps roles. Responsibilities include leading a team in achieving goals, fostering an environment of trust and teamwork, contributing to roadmap development, and collaborating with other engineering teams. Must have proficiency in JavaScript, Java, .NET technologies, and experience with Cloud Services, particularly AWS. Bachelor's degree in Computer Science, Engineering, or Quality Assurance required.
Passionate Site Reliability Engineer needed at KUBRA to ensure high availability, security, and performance in cloud environments. Responsibilities include maintaining SLAs and SLOs, automation, incident management, and collaboration with teams. Requires attention to detail, collaboration skills, and proficiency in AWS, Kubernetes, Terraform, and scripting languages. Bachelor's degree in relevant field and certifications preferred.
Senior Software Engineer responsible for design, implementation, modification, and maintenance of systems. Engages with IT management and development teams to ensure successful delivery of technology-based solutions. Participates in full software development lifecycle, mentors other engineers, and manages multiple projects using various technologies.
Featured Jobs
As a QA Engineer at KUBRA, you will be responsible for designing and maintaining test plans, creating automated tests, and performing various types of testing on web-based applications. The role also involves troubleshooting system issues, assisting in deploying software applications, and ensuring the quality of new product results against existing applications. The ideal candidate will have a Bachelor's degree in Computer Science or a related field, 4-5 years of QA or test automation experience, and proficiency in automation testing tools like Cypress.
Seeking a Senior Data Engineer to design and maintain data infrastructure and ETL processes, collaborate with the Data Analytics team, and provide BI analysis. Responsibilities include building and optimizing scalable data architectures, integrating data from diverse sources, and creating dimensional models. Must have 5-7 years of cloud experience, hands-on experience with big data technologies, and proficiency in SQL and AWS stack. Undergraduate or Masters degree in relevant fields is required.
Join KUBRA as a Java Software Engineer to design and build software, translate business requirements, contribute to product architecture, and collaborate with teams to develop product roadmaps. Must have a minimum of 3 years of experience in Java environments and proficiency in Java, Spring, Spring Boot, Java EE, and related technologies.
Design and implement controlled multi-account AWS environments, provide Kubernetes solutions, develop infrastructure as code using Terraform, automate deployment processes, and collaborate with development teams to optimize infrastructure.
Lead small, cross-functional software engineering teams dedicated to building and maintaining a diverse product portfolio. Plan, execute, and elevate the development of cutting-edge products in a collaborative environment. Foster trust, open communication, and creative thinking among team members. Manage products and tasks using various technologies and contribute to software architecture.
All Filters
No Results
No Results